Innovation is taking flight from Gujarat’s Vadodara as a father-son duo claims to have developed an AI-based indigenous satellite prototype aimed at supporting India’s future in space technology. Innovator Mithilesh Patel and his 17-year-old son, Vraj, have introduced ‘Rakshoghna’, a concept satellite designed to identify space debris and improve navigation for future space missions.

According to the young innovator, the AI-powered prototype uses onboard cameras and intelligent navigation systems to position itself in space and respond to environmental and operational challenges. The duo also says the technology is envisioned to contribute toward addressing global concerns linked to climate change and sustainable space operations.

Although currently at the prototype stage, the creators plan to showcase Rakshoghna at the upcoming Vibrant Gujarat Regional Startup Event in Vadodara. A patent application for the innovation has already been filed.
